Transaction 8a14a5108d512896c16d611065b35276469cbee473be70fee106dd70482ed56a
1 Input
1 Output
-
8a14a5108d512896c16d611065b35276469cbee473be70fee106dd70482ed56a:0
- value
- 325656
- script pubkey
- OP_0 OP_PUSHBYTES_20 649403a788c407a4ef30405407f1055839e56662
- address
- bc1qvj2q8fugcsr6fmesgp2q0ug9tqu72enz8efwpd